The US vitamin A market is divided into several major categories by type. Natural vitamin A derived from natural sources such as fish liver oil and vegetables accounts for a significant portion of the market share due to increasing consumer preference for natural and organic products. Synthetic vitamin A, produced through chemical processes, also plays an important role in the market, especially in fortified foods and dietary supplements where precise dosing is required. Processed vitamin A, such as retinyl palmitate and retinyl acetate, is widely used in cosmetics and pharmaceuticals due to its stability and effectiveness in skin treatment. Fortified vitamin A, added to staple foods and beverages to address nutritional deficiencies, is steadily growing due to government initiatives and public health campaigns. Finally, feed-grade vitamin A is essential in animal feed formulations to ensure proper growth and health of livestock, contributing significantly to the demand in the agricultural sector.

The US vitamin A market is segmented by application, with diverse applications across several key sectors. In the food and beverage industry, vitamin A is primarily used as a food additive to fortify products such as dairy products, cereals, and juices to increase their nutritional content and meet regulatory standards.
Nutritional supplements also play an important role. In this segment, vitamin A is consumed in various forms such as capsules, tablets, and softgels to meet the needs of consumers seeking improved health and wellness. Additionally, in animal feed applications, vitamin A plays an important role in maintaining livestock health and increasing productivity. In cosmetics, it is used in formulations such as creams, lotions, and anti-aging products due to its skin-positive properties. Finally, pharmaceutical uses of vitamin A focus on the use of vitamin A in pharmaceutical formulations to treat conditions related to vision, skin health, and overall immunity.
